How Much Does Popcorn Ceiling Repair Cost?

Sometimes your "popcorn" ceiling texture will become saturated and start to flake off, and popcorn ceiling repair becomes necessary. "Popcorn" is an older type of ceiling texture made with stucco. It offers a few benefits, such as drywall seam concealment and noise absorption. However, it tends to be one of the more difficult surfaces to fix. Repairs may prove necessary if a water leak or natural disaster damages it, and this surface can also develop cracks over time.

How Much Does It Cost to Repair a Popcorn Ceiling?

Labor is the biggest expense when you pay a contractor to complete this task. On average, workers' wages will add about $350 to the bill. Special tools are needed to perform popcorn ceiling repair. They include texture spraying devices and taping equipment. Contractors charge each customer around $40 to fund the acquisition and maintenance of these tools. A relatively small portion of the bill covers materials. The compound, seam tape and other supplies only cost approximately $25 per patch. Keep in mind that insurance, training and various other overhead expenses must be included in the price.

What Makes the Cost of this Service Rise or Fall?

A contractor will adjust the overall cost to repair a popcorn ceiling based on the following:

  • materials needed
  • labor
  • size of the area that needs work
  • preparing the work area
  • damage severity and size
  • how hard is it to reach

Popcorn ceiling repair involves sanding or scraping the existing material, mixing a new compound and applying it properly. Additionally, you might pay more if the "popcorn" contains asbestos. This hazardous material may be present if it's over 25 years old. Most homeowners hire professionals to achieve optimal results.

The cost to repair a popcorn ceiling varies based on how badly the surface was damaged. Your entire ceiling could need replacement if it's in particularly poor condition. You will also pay extra when a contractor needs to cover or move numerous belongings to protect them from dust and drips. It's always best to clear the area beforehand if possible.

Nationwide Low, Average and High Pricing Estimates

Most repair bills fall within a one-hundred dollar range. If your ceiling is comparatively easy to fix, you might spend around $300 - $350. Some people pay as much as $400, especially if their ceilings are high or difficult to access (above a stairway, for example). Large cracks or water-damaged areas could also cause the price to reach this level. 

One more important factor is your home's address. People generally pay more in places with higher wages, commercial insurance rates, taxes or equipment costs. Since this isn't one of the most common house repairs, people in some rural areas may find it difficult to locate nearby contractors who fix "popcorn", which could result in higher transportation expenses.
